    Abstract: An apparatus and methods for recognizing an image with an increased image recognition rate are provided. The apparatus includes a plurality of illuminators for illuminating a surface. The apparatus also includes an image sensor for outputting an image frame obtained by converting an optical image of the surface into an electrical signal. The surface is illuminated one of the plurality of illuminators. The apparatus further includes a switch for selecting any of the plurality of illuminators for illuminating the surface. The apparatus additionally includes a controller for receiving the image frame from the image sensor, determining whether the image frame has a region of reflected light, and controlling the switch to select another of the plurality of illuminators to illuminate the surface when the image frame has the region of reflected light.

    Abstract: Apparatuses and methods which provide synchronized data using visible light communication are described. In one method, a first Light Emitting Diode (LED) lighting apparatus, which has a checked Identification (ID), receives a synchronization signal from a mobile communication network. This synchronization signal is analyzed in order to synchronize the first LED lighting apparatus with at least one second LED lighting apparatus adjacent to the first LED lighting apparatus. A synchronized time slot is prepared using the synchronization signal and a period of the time slot is determined, using the checked ID of the first LED apparatus, for transmitting data of the first LED lighting apparatus to a mobile terminal.

    Abstract: A method and an apparatus acting as a server for estimating parameters of data transfer across a communication network are provided. The server includes a transceiver which enables data transfer operations and an estimator which estimates throughput as one of the parameters of the data transfer operations. The estimator further determines an indicator value of the throughput corresponding to an estimated bottleneck bandwidth (eBnBW) calculated from data traffic measurements. The indicator value is attributable to and indicates optimal parameters of the data transfer operations, calculated from measurements associated with the data traffic. The server apparatus includes a processor, in communication with the transceiver and the estimator, and the processor is configured to control for preparing succeeding data transfer operations to a client apparatus through the communication network based on the estimated bottleneck bandwidth determined by the estimator.
